Scope: plugin authors only. Use break-glass when the widget API gateway is down and your plugin needs direct datastore reads. Steps: open the emergency console, select the Moonwake tenant, declare an incident tag, confirm. Access lasts 30 minutes, read-only, fully audited. Abuse revokes your plugin key. Do not script this path; it is rate-limited to one activation per author per day. The console requires the break-glass recovery passphrase before granting the session. Enter the passphrase below exactly as written.

unlock words, yawig-kagef: gordor-holvan-ulaael-pramir-ulaiel-tamdor

Capacity note for the Bramblewick export retry queue. Failed exports are requeued with exponential backoff, and the queue depth is our main capacity signal: sustained depth above the high-water mark means downstream Pellis storage is saturated, not that we need more workers. As the new contractor, please don't raise worker counts without checking storage latency first — it usually makes things worse. Retry timing, backoff caps, and the high-water threshold are all driven by the constants shown below.

limits module of yagef-bajog:
TIERS = {
    "druael": 370,
    "tamix": 286,
    "pelius": 541,
    "pelael": 78,
    "pelox": 47,
    "ralath": 533,
    "drumir": 801,
}

CI note — PickPath optimizer (Larkwell Logistics). The nightly optimizer build on runner pool "delta" has been failing intermittently since the solver library bump. The failure appears only when the constraint-pruning tests run in parallel; serial runs pass cleanly. Before restarting the pipeline, capture the runner's scratch directory and confirm the heuristic seed matches the one in the job config. If you need to escalate to the Fenwick team, quote the trace token that appears below.

build token for kagaf-hahof: htk14_9d3d4d26d7d8de

Break-glass access: SquatWatch

Quick notes for the weekly sync. SquatWatch is our typo-squatting package scanner; if it goes dark, malicious lookalike packages can slip into the Pellbrook registry, so we keep a break-glass path. Use it only when both regular admins are unreachable and the scanner has been down 30+ minutes. Grab the sealed envelope from the ops locker, log the incident in #squatwatch-alerts, and ping whoever's on call. The break-glass login prompts for the passphrase below.

unlock words, tagaf-tawif: quenys-zordor-aldius-caswyn